- 博客(19)
- 资源 (30)
- 收藏
- 关注
原创 移位运算(部分笔试题)
一、x=a/2;等价于x=a>>1;右移则幂次变小 x=a*2;等价于x=a(left,center),(center+1,right)=>(1,2),(3) 或者,=>(left,center-1),(center,right)=>(1),(2,3) 2、偶数,如1,2=>(left,center),(center+1,right)=>(1),(2) 或者,=>(left,cente
2011-03-31 16:55:00 1670
原创 如何证明平方和公式?
证明如下: 已知(n+1)3 = n3+3n2+3n+1 则与如下一系列等式成立: (n+1)3-n3=3(n2+n)+1 n3-(n-1)3=3((n-1)2+(n-1))+1 ………… 23-13=3(12+1)+1 等式两边相加: (n+1)3-1 = 3[n2+…+12]+3*n(n+1)/2+n 故,12+22+32+……+n2是为n(n+1
2011-03-30 13:57:00 2713
原创 时间复杂度(分析程序效率)
关于时间复杂度,参看http://blog.csdn.net/zhuchzhi/archive/2007/03/14/1529514.aspx 总结如下: 1、如果函数中没有n,也就是语句执行的次数是恒定的,则可知时间复杂度为O(1) 2、如果函数中有n,但是不知道执行的次数,可以这样做:假设执行次数为m,经过m次执行后条件参数变为x1且常数增长,则O(x)比O(y)增长得快些,即高效性:O(x)
2011-03-28 17:42:00 3698 2
原创 window live writer出现日志服务器错误
发布日志后,如果点击"最近发布的日志",然后对其修改后再点击"发布",有可能会出现下面的问题! 日志服务器错误 - 发生服务器错误 0 用户名/密码错误,或没有相关权限!editPost 从字面"editPost"我们不难看出,是从远程服务器上下载后,做出修改,而后上传后失败! 解决办法: 将该日志保存到另一个地方,然后删除该日志,"新建"(不要在原来的基础上改!经验之谈),重新写一篇,将原内容copy过来,然后上传即可!
2011-03-25 10:03:00 1551
原创 dblp数据源中的crossref标签
dblp中有个标签叫"crossref"。它代表一种链接关系,具体表现为"一篇paper属于哪个journal/conf,或者说通过crossref标签内的值可以找到它对应的journal/conf"。 在inproceedings和article中,有的地方有"crossref"标签,而有的地方却没有!why?我试图来回答这个问题。 在此之前,key值的含义没有完全挖掘,
2011-03-25 09:49:00 3408
原创 计算机中各种数制间的转化(10进制与2、8、16进制之间的快速转化)
最近看数据结构的书,回顾下以前学的东西。无意间翻到了stack这章,我就在想,为什么要使用栈这种数据结构?它的底层不也就是数组或者链表来实现的吗?于是,希望能从书中找到答案(其实我之前也猜想,无非是和pattern类似,封装了一层,便于使用嘛)。书里讲了几个例子来说明stack的用法。其中一个就是"数制转化",一个古老的话题,学计算机的都会知道。结尾处作者如是说,摘抄如下:栈的引入简化了程序设计的问题,划分了不同的关注层次,使思考范围缩小了,而用数组不仅掩盖了问题的本质,还要分散精力去考虑数组下
2011-03-23 23:21:00 23501
原创 berkeley db 中secondaryDatabase的用法 and 构建索引
简单介绍下bdb中索引的构建。 为什么要构建索引? 由于bdb是key/value型数据库,我们通常是通过key值来检索数据。可是,实际运用中,我们更希望能够通过value中的某些值来得到这样一整条记录。显然仅仅靠key来检索是不可行的。原文摘抄如下:Usually you find database records by means of the record's
2011-03-22 17:05:00 3158
原创 java的异常捕获中可能出现的小问题
1: public int exTest(){ 2: int x = 0; 3: try{ 4: 5: String y = null; 6: y.codePointAt(1); 7: x=1; 8: System.out.println("hello");
2011-03-21 17:24:00 1211
原创 Berkeley db 基本操作代码(基础)
最近学习Berkeley DB Java Edition(JE版)。写一个浅显的例子,入门吧~至于什么是bdb,请参考bdb中国研发团队的这篇文章package com.berkeley.dbje; import java.io.File;import java.io.UnsupportedEncodingException; import com.sleepycat.bin
2011-03-21 16:51:00 1791
原创 java字符串处理常见问题(不断补充)
一、字符串相关函数的操作 1、indexOf(String str, int fromIndex)//返回指定子字符串在此字符串中第一次出现处的索引,从指定的索引开始。 说明:字符串的索引从0开始! 2、substring(int beginIndex, int endIndex)//返回一个新字符串,它是此字符串的一个子字符串。 说明:返回的字符串是beginIndex~endIndex-1,因此得到的字符串长度为endIndex-beginIndex 例如:"hamburger"
2011-03-19 16:40:00 1889
原创 DBLP数据构成浅析(二)
五、incolletion 有两种形式 01、 或者 02、 一般incollection这种paper是放在book(书)里面的。两种形式的区别是: 01这种,是放在journal下,如果想找到包含该paper的书,则优先选择中的内容来进行寻找。而02这种,没有提供对book的链接,因此只能依据来引用。 存在的关系: Author---->write)------Book Paper(incollection)--------查找的。也就是说解析book时需要保存中的内容(如果有的话),
2011-03-18 23:50:00 5612 4
原创 DBLP数据结构浅析(一)
除标签外的一级标签有: article inproceedings proceedings book incollection phdthesis mastersthesis www 一般分类如下: “phd”: phdthesis eg. . "phd/Mumick91" “ms”: mastersthesis eg.. "ms/Vollmer2006" “www”: www e
2011-03-18 23:40:00 4563
原创 UML补充学习(关联、依赖、聚合、组合、泛化)
有幸看到一篇不错的文章,出自http://student.csdn.net/space.php?uid=1394199&do=blog&id=51397&page=2#content 由于作者不允许转载,因此仅附上链接并摘取了其中部分重点内容,支持原创,坚持学习。 1、关联(Association)。指类之间的引用关系。是实体域对象之间最普遍使用最广泛的一种关系,分为一对一,一对多,多对多。在代码中如何体现?在类A中,引入类B的对象作为A类的一个属性。这样就建立了一对一或一对多关联。
2011-03-17 15:53:00 2586
原创 局部内部类引用外部类中的局部变量必须是final属性的!
如例中所示,声明了一个局部内部类TimerPrint,这个类中的方法引用了一个局部变量testTxt,必须声明为final!!why? 逻辑上:因为该内部类出现在一个方法的内部,但实际编译时,内部类编译为Outer$1TimerPrint.class,这说明,外部类的这个方法和内部类是处于同一级别的。换句话说是两者的生命周期不一样!start被调用后,非final变量也会随之消失,就会出现内部类引用非法!但是作用域范围相关(该内部类的作用域就在该方法体内)。 实际做法:java编译器的行为是这样的
2011-03-15 16:12:00 5685
原创 java中写入文件时换行符是用"/r/n"还是"/n"?
java中写入文件时换行符是用"/r/n"还是"/n"? /r 叫回车 Carriage Return /n 叫新行 New Line 但是都会造成换行 使用 System.getProperty("line.separator")来获取当前OS的换行符,可以在调试的情况下看到! 各系统应当是: /r Mac /n Unix/Linux /r/n Windows 这种输出的主要表现在用notepad打开时的显示。使用其他编辑器则没有明显变化!!
2011-03-14 14:03:00 11417
原创 安装Eclipse HTML Editor Plugin后出现"an swt error has occurred"
解决办法:SWT Browser widget (HTMLEditor uses it for preview HTML and JSP) requires Mozilla in the Linux. See details atThe SWT FAQ. Also you can disable preview in the preference dialog. Choose[Wind
2011-03-09 15:13:00 2130
原创 eclipse中运行jsp程序时出现的异常“JETEmitters’is missing required library”
在部署好eclipse和tomcatPlugin插件后,在error提示栏会出现这样的问题:原因是说缺少一个jar包,但是在网上找了半天也没找到。打开这个目录后有如下文件最后,有个比较笨的办法。就是切换workspace!新建一个新的workspace,然后再配置参数或者新建工程。这样就可以直接运行了。网上说出现这个问题的原因都不是很清楚。所以暂且只能这样处理了。不知道
2011-03-08 23:13:00 1632
windows远程连接ubuntu
2013-08-26
usb网卡驱动
2011-09-14
U盘检测工具(disktest)
2010-05-13
Windows Live Writer代码插件
2010-05-13
wlw_SyntaxHighlight.rar
2010-05-13
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人